Output c250d4ab5432460f148425929f2a8c873819d6c802e09eb6082bed6c8f61e24a:20

value
217570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42d3ca941e33309a86d47304d37683726304a8e OP_EQUAL
address
3Px6zUAyAeeX6AhQKJechEEFMHtnwSCuPy
transaction
c250d4ab5432460f148425929f2a8c873819d6c802e09eb6082bed6c8f61e24a
confirmations
222766
spent
true